In this very special episode, Jaime and Patrick were honored to sit down with Blade Runner Production Executive Katy Haber. From her work with director Sam Peckinpah on Straw Dogs and many other films, to her time with director director Samuel Fuller, Ms. Haber takes us on a tour through filmmaking through her eyes. The world of Blade Runner has had a consistent shroud of mystery over it since its release in 1982. From the rain-soaked streets to the neon signs illuminating the city, there is no corner that's not riddled with questions and shadow. Infiltrating this environment is the presence of a massive amount police. They're on every corner of seemingly every street. In this episode, Patrick & Jaime dive into discussing why the police have such a military-style presence and how that affects the world they inhabit. We hope you enjoy!
